It's been a long time since I played this hack, and yes, it qualifies as Nintendo Hard. However, the only cheat code I actually used was the Walk Through Walls code, and only for the seventh gym, because screw wasting however many hours it takes to figure out how to get past those damn sliding boulders.

While I myself didn't use this, after the seventh gym you can obtain one of the game's Pickup users, which would make the rest of the main game somewhat easier since Rare Candies can be used as Revives outside of battle.

Also, Nimbleaf is the best starter IMO, though you'll have to grind it to around Level 33 (if not 36 to reach its final form) and get a little lucky if you don't want to get swept by the Water gym's lead Starmie. And grinding is much more time consuming than on most hacks.

My endgame team for the first E4 run was Caudaleaf, Houndoom, Hantama, Walrein, Lilapse, and Zapdos, the last one being built to tank special attacks. Looking back on it, I don't like that I ended up using multiple legendaries, but considering that Lilapse is one of only a few Ground-types that doesn't lose to most Electric-types...
